Warranty

Warranty
Warranty basics
Challenger Lifts, Inc. (CLI) warrants its lifts to the original owner only; the coverage is not transferable. CLI will, at its discretion, repair or replace any part that is found on inspection to be defective during the applicable warranty period. Coverage applies only when the lift is installed, operated, and maintained in line with CLI's installation, operation, and maintenance instructions. Using unapproved parts or accessories voids the warranty, as does any repair attempted by someone who is not a CLI authorized service representative. Normal maintenance, adjustments, wear and tear, and damage from improper handling, abuse, misuse, or negligence are not covered. The warranty is valid only if the lift is registered with Challenger Lifts; registration must be completed online (challengerlifts.com/register-your-lift), otherwise the warranty period begins from the invoice date of purchase.
Warranty length
5 years on structural parts, 2 years on functional parts, and 1 year on labor. Structural parts include the carriage, columns, column extensions, overhead beams, arms, cross beams, runways, wheel stops, ramps, bolsters, sync rails, and plungers. Functional parts include power units, cylinders, sheaves, sheave pins, hoses, hydraulic and pneumatic fittings, cables, adapters, latches, valves, and controls.

FAQs

What is the lifting capacity of the Challenger EV1020? ▾
The EV1020 and EV1020-QC models have a 10,000 lb lifting capacity with 2,500 lbs per arm. The XP9 drive-on pad models (EV1020XP9 and EV1020XP9-QC) have a 9,000 lb capacity with 4,500 lbs per pad. All models are ALI/ETL certified for professional use.
What is the difference between standard and Quick Cycle (QC) models? ▾
Quick Cycle models reduce vehicle travel time by 30 percent. Standard models rise in 38 seconds, while QC models rise in just 27 seconds and lower in only 17 seconds. This increased speed improves technician productivity in high-volume service environments.
What electrical power does the EV1020 require? ▾
The EV1020 requires 208V-230V, 60Hz, single-phase power. The lift uses a 2HP motor. A licensed electrician should install and verify the electrical supply meets all requirements and local codes.
What is the difference between the standard arms and XP9 drive-on pads? ▾
Standard EV1020 models feature 3-stage front and rear lifting arms with adjustable reach from 19.625" to 42.125", ideal for accessing vehicle lift points. XP9 models use drive-on style pads that aid in quick vehicle spotting, making them better suited for express service bays where speed is critical.
What are the installation requirements for an inground lift? ▾
Inground lift installation requires excavation and concrete work to accommodate the cassette tub, a 208V-230V single-phase electrical supply, and 90-120 PSI compressed air. Professional installation is strongly recommended to ensure safe operation and maintain warranty coverage.
How is the EV1020 shipped and what do I need for delivery? ▾
The EV1020 ships via freight to commercial addresses in the 48 contiguous states with free shipping. You will need a forklift or loading dock to unload the equipment. Curbside delivery is standard. Always inspect shipments for damage before signing the bill of lading.
What colors are available for the EV1020? ▾
The EV1020 and EV1020-QC models with arms are available in Red, Blue, or Black powder coat finish. The XP9 drive-on pad models are available in Black only. The premium powder coat finish provides long-lasting durability.
What is the drive-thru clearance and why does it matter? ▾
The EV1020 provides 87" drive-thru clearance between the arms, accommodating wider vehicles and minimizing tire damage during positioning. This generous clearance makes vehicle spotting easier and faster, improving shop efficiency.
How does the cassette tub protect against contamination? ▾
The fully-contained and sealed recycled polymer cassette tub completely encloses the hydraulic components, eliminating any risk of hydraulic fluid seeping into the ground. This environmentally responsible design protects your facility from contamination liability.
